在数字化时代,区块链技术以其去中心化、安全性高、不可篡改等特点,成为了一个热门的领域。无论是加密货币、供应链管理还是身份验证,区块链都在逐步改变着我们的生活方式。然而,随着区块链技术的普及,其安全性也成为了公众关注的焦点。今天,我们就来揭秘区块链安全防护的奥秘,一起守护我们的数字资产和钱袋子。
区块链安全防护的重要性
区块链安全防护是保障数字资产安全的关键。由于区块链的开放性和分布式特性,任何参与其中的节点都可以访问账本,这虽然提高了透明度,但也为攻击者提供了可乘之机。一旦区块链被攻击,后果不堪设想,不仅可能导致巨额财富流失,还会影响整个生态的稳定性。
区块链安全防护的关键点
1. 加密算法
区块链安全的核心在于其加密算法。加密算法确保了交易数据的机密性,防止未经授权的访问。常见的加密算法包括:
- 非对称加密:如RSA、ECC等,可以保证数据传输的加密和数字签名。
- 对称加密:如AES,适用于大规模数据的加密。
2. 共识机制
共识机制是区块链网络中节点达成共识的一种算法,如工作量证明(PoW)、权益证明(PoS)等。这些机制确保了网络的安全和去中心化。攻击者要攻破区块链,必须同时攻破多数节点,这大大增加了攻击难度。
3. 隐私保护
区块链虽然公开透明,但同时也暴露了用户的隐私信息。隐私保护技术如零知识证明、匿名币等,可以在不影响透明性的前提下,保护用户的隐私。
4. 智能合约安全
智能合约是区块链上的一种自执行合同,但其安全性也一直备受关注。为了提高智能合约的安全性,开发者和用户需要遵循以下原则:
- 代码审计:对智能合约进行严格的代码审查,确保无安全漏洞。
- 最小权限原则:智能合约只应拥有执行所需的最小权限,以防止权限滥用。
5. 硬件钱包
硬件钱包是存储数字资产的一种安全设备,它可以离线操作,有效防止在线攻击。与软件钱包相比,硬件钱包的安全性更高,是保护资产的最佳选择。
如何守护你的数字资产
1. 了解基础知识
了解区块链、加密货币、智能合约等基础知识,可以帮助你更好地认识区块链的安全防护,从而采取措施保护自己的资产。
2. 严格遵循安全指南
在操作数字资产时,要严格遵守安全指南,如设置强密码、定期备份、不随意点击不明链接等。
3. 使用多重验证
多重验证可以提高账户的安全性。例如,除了密码,还可以使用生物识别、手机短信验证码等方式进行双重或三重验证。
4. 警惕骗局
警惕各种骗局,如虚假投资、虚假交易所等。不要轻易相信高回报的投资项目,谨防上当受骗。
总之,区块链安全防护是守护数字资产的关键。通过了解区块链安全的关键点,采取有效的措施,我们可以更好地保护自己的钱袋子。让我们共同为数字时代的资产安全保驾护航。
